Tyholmen Old Town

5
(1)
Tyholmen Old Town is one of the most charming and historic areas in Arendal, Norway. This preserved district is known for its white wooden houses, narrow streets, and calm coastal atmosphere. Walking through Tyholmen allows visitors to experience traditional Norwegian town life, where maritime history, architecture, and everyday local living blend naturally. For travelers, Tyholmen Old Town offers a peaceful cultural walk just minutes away from Arendal’s modern harbor and town center.

Opening Hours & Entry

Open:

24 hours

Entry Fee:

Free

Best Time to Visit:

Morning or evening for calm walks and photography

Location

📌Tyholmen Old Town, Arendal, Agder, Norway
